| Overview | Koito Ware Pottery (Hida Takayama City) is a traditional kiln with roots dating back to the Edo Kan’ei period. While carrying on the tradition of the “Irabo” glaze, they also offer their own unique, sophisticated cobalt blue “Aoi Irabo.” They handle a wide range of products, from tableware for everyday use to tea ceremony utensils, and enjoy tea using local tableware and Hida matcha. At this long-established tea shop, founded in 1880, we offer a matcha tea ceremony experience that even those with no tea ceremony experience can enjoy. Dress code and etiquette are optional, so you can participate in casual attire. Enjoy a moment of exposure to Japanese culture as you sip matcha and savor Japanese sweets under the guidance of our staff. |
